Transaction 59b7bb8ece85535f3ae64e287b59324604b5581794e3e85cadfb49db9bb4ced4
1 Input
1 Output
-
59b7bb8ece85535f3ae64e287b59324604b5581794e3e85cadfb49db9bb4ced4:0
- value
- 3721424
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 99acf28ba837c87bf2d5fc050ed7f7b9d20cf6ee OP_EQUALVERIFY OP_CHECKSIG
- address
- 1F1ZZx3kYsUCoQtsZ33MMMPrb5r8L5nibS